Re: Engine wont Start

Post by money_greenmx3 »

Lol wow thoose bastards at canadian tire saw me buying spark plugs and told me to buy dielelectric grease and put in on top half of spark plugs, wires, and rotor. Should i wipe of the grease from everything or just the rotor and how can i get all the grease of not with water, rubbing alcohol rite?
Thanks a lot for your help guys as you seen Im a newbie but hey im young and learning.

Re: Engine wont Start

Post by Ryan »

well. I guess its okay, but just make sure its not interfering with the connections. Don't put it on any of the contacts, the center of the cap/rotor... etc.

Dielectric is meant to stop sparks from jumping, so around the boots and etc. Not for the contacts.
